body { background-color: #ffffff; font-size: 11px; font-family: Helvetica, Arial, SunSans-Regular, sans-serif }

#divAll   { position: absolute; z-index: 1; top: 0; bottom: 0; left:auto; width: 750px; right:auto; }
#divMenu  { position: absolute; z-index: 10; top: 186px; left: 0px; width: 185px;  }

#divScroll { position: absolute; top: 0; bottom: 0; left: 0; right: 0; overflow: auto; }

#divMenuBG  { position: absolute; top: 165px; left: 10px; width: 185px; bottom: 0; background-color: #202342; }
#divRechtsBG  { position: absolute; top: 165px; left: 585px; width: 185px; bottom: 0; background-color: #B3CBE3; }


#divBannerPortrait  { position: absolute; z-index: 3; top: 0px; left: 0px; width: 185px; height: 165px; overflow: hidden }
#divSeitenkopf  { position: absolute; z-index: 3; top: 0px; left: 185px; width: 565px; height: 38px }

#divBalken  { background-color: #B3CBE3; position: absolute; z-index: 0; top: 7px; right: 0; left: 0; height: 30px }
#divBalken2 { background-color: #22466B; position: absolute; z-index: 0; top: 45px; right: 0; left: 0; height: 120px }

#divLinks  { background-color: #202342; color: white; position: absolute; z-index: 3; top: 45; bottom: 0; left: 0; width: 185px; padding-top: 10px;}

#divBannerBild { position: absolute; top: 45px; left: 185px; width: 565px; height: 120px }
#divBannerBildText { position: absolute; top: 45px; left: 185px; width: 375px; height: 120px }

#divMain  { position: absolute; z-index: 2; top: 165px; bottom: 0; left: 0; width: 750px }

#divBGlinks { background-color: #202342; position: absolute; z-index: 1; top: 0; bottom: 0; left: 0; width: 185px }
#divBalken3 { background-color: #B3CBE3;position: absolute; z-index: 2; top: 7px; left: 0; width: 750px; height: 30px }
#Content  { position: absolute; top: 19px; left: 194px; width: 361px; height: 100px; z-index: 2; }

#menuMain   { color: #B3CBE3; font-size: 14px; font-weight: bold; text-decoration: none; margin-right: 0; letter-spacing: 1px;  padding-left: 10px;}
#menuMain:hover, #menuMainActive  { color: #ffed00; font-size: 14px; font-weight: bold; text-decoration: none; margin-right: 0; letter-spacing: 1px;  padding-left: 10px;}

#menuSub, #menuSubActive { color: #004da0; font-size: 12px; font-weight: bold; text-decoration: none; }
#menuSub:hover, #menuSubActive, #menuSubActive:hover { color: #202342 }

#menuSub2, #menuSub2Active { color: #004da0; font-size: 11px; font-weight: bold; text-decoration: none; }
#menuSub2:hover, #menuSub2Active, #menuSubActive:hover { color: #202342 }

#divRechts { background-color: #B3CBE3; position: absolute; top: 0; bottom: 0; left: 565px; width: 185px; z-index: 1; margin-bottom:-24px; }

.submenu {display: none; position: absolute; top: 21px; margin-top: -26px; left: 120px; text-align: left; border: 0px solid black;  padding-bottom: 10px; padding-right: 10px; background-image:url('http://www.metatag.de/designs/mattar/img/weiss.88.2x2.png'); width:120px; }
#menuMain,#menuMainActive {display:block; height: 40px; padding-right: 10px; }
#menuSub,#menuSubActive,#menuSub2,#menuSub2Active,#menuSub3,#menuSub3Active {display:block; height: 10px; padding-left: 10px; padding-top: 10px; width:180px; background-image:url('http://www.metatag.de/img/spacer.gif');}
#menuSub2,#menuSub2Active {padding-left:15px; height:10px; font-weight: bold; padding-top: 5px; }
#menuSub3,#menuSub3Active {padding-left:20px; height:15px; }

.box { top: 0; left: 0; position: relative; width: 100%; }
.boxLCol { top: 0; left: 0; position: absolute; width: 48%; }
.boxRCol { top: 0; left: 52%; position: absolute; width: 48%; }

.boxWhite { top: 0; left: 0; position: relative; width: 100%; background-color: #ffffff; padding-top: 10px; padding-left: 10px; padding-right: 10px; }

.bannerRight {top: 19px; left: 10px; width: 165px; position: absolute; }

.bannerLeft {top: 19px; left: 10px; width: 165px; position: absolute; color: #ffffff; }
.bL { color: #ffffff; }

.countdown { COLOR: #fbee31; FONT-SIZE: 18px }
.countdown:hover { color:#ffffff }
